The coastal path between Goodrington and Torquay passes mainly through urban area, but the section from Sharkham Point to Kingswear affords spectacular coastal scenery (for the energetic, the car can be left at the Churston Court for a walk to Kingswear, and a steamtrain ride back to Churston).
Two areas not to be missed are Berry Head, a National Nature Reserve with more than 200 different bird species recorded, and seabird colonies, and Cockington with varied wildlife organic garden and rural skills.
